Abstract

The utility model discloses a radiator with shock absorption function, comprising a main body which takes the shape of an inverted groove. The main body forms a flute profile space with an opening part and comprises a plurality of strip-shaped fins uniformly distributed on the external surface of the main body. The main body is provided with cushioning devices on both sides. The utility model, which has the advantages of good shock absorption effect, simple structure and convenient installation and operation, can be widely used as cooling devices of various types of computer hard disks.

Description

A kind of heating radiator with shock-absorbing function
Technical field
The utility model relates to a kind of heating radiator, relates in particular to a kind of heating radiator with shock-absorbing function.
Background technology
In computer host box, hard disk is one of the most accurate and main heater members in the computing machine, and the hard disk that therefore both needed protection also needs to dispose heating radiator simultaneously, so that dispel the heat effectively.The Hard disk heat radiation device all adopts rigid contact in the market, because hard disk in use runs up, is easy to generate vibrations and noise, and hard disk is damaged, and reduces its serviceable life.In addition, do not dispose corresponding heat radiator on the known Hard disk heat radiation device, area of dissipation is less, can not take away too much heat.
Summary of the invention
The technical problems to be solved in the utility model is the defective that overcomes prior art, and a kind of have shock-absorbing function, radiating efficiency height, installation and heating radiator easy to use are provided.
For solving the problems of the technologies described above, the utility model provides a kind of heating radiator with shock-absorbing function, comprises body, and described body is ㄇ shape, and described body formation one has the flute profile space of peristome, is provided with shock attenuation device in the both sides of described body.
Wherein, described shock attenuation device comprises damping nut and fixed installation hole, and described damping nut comprises shock reducing structure, is provided with screw at an end of described shock reducing structure, and the other end is provided with threaded mounting hole, and threaded mounting hole is used for being connected with installing component in the cabinet.Described fixed installation hole is arranged on the both sides of described body, offers the screw with described screw fit on its inner side end.
As a kind of improvement of the present utility model, described shock reducing structure is cylindrical or cube shaped, and other any suitable shape.
As optimal way of the present utility model, described shock reducing structure is an elastic rubber material.
Be evenly distributed with the fin of some bar shapeds on the outside surface of described body, such design has increased area of dissipation, has improved radiating efficiency.
The utility model heating radiator also comprises front panel, rear panel and the base plate that is connected with described body two ends and bottom surface respectively.Be respectively arranged with at least two fixed orifices on described front panel, rear panel, position corresponding with described fixed orifice on described body is provided with the contraposition mounting hole, and screw is located in described fixed orifice and the contraposition mounting hole.
As another improvement of the present utility model, described rear panel bottom is provided with open slot, and rear panel is ㄇ shape.The bottom side portion of described body both sides is provided with the limited step that extends outward, and described limited step and described base plate are provided with mounting hole, and screw is located in the described mounting hole.

Embodiment
As shown in Figures 1 to 4, the utlity model has the heating radiator of shock-absorbing function, comprise body 1, body 1 is ㄇ shape, and formation one has the flute profile space of peristome, hard disc of computer can place in this flute profile space, be included in the fin 2 of the equally distributed some bar shapeds of its outside surface, be provided with at least two fixed installation holes 3 in the both sides of body 1, fixed installation hole 3 is the cylindrical shape of indent, and the side end face offers screw within it, is separately installed with damping nut 4 on fixed installation hole 3.Damping nut 4 comprises cylindrical or cube shaped shock reducing structure 14, an end of shock reducing structure 14 be provided with fixedly mount hole 3 in the screw 13 that cooperates of the screw that is provided with, the other end is provided with threaded mounting hole 12, is used for being connected with installing component in the cabinet.Damping nut 4 can adopt various flexible materials, is preferably elastic rubber material.
The utility model product radiator also comprises front panel 5, rear panel 6 and the base plate 10 that is connected with body 1 two ends and bottom surface respectively.Be respectively arranged with at least two fixed orifices 7 on plate 5, the rear panel 6 in front, position corresponding with fixed orifice 7 on body 1 is provided with contraposition mounting hole 8, contraposition screw 11 is located in fixed orifice 7 and the contraposition mounting hole 8, front panel 5, rear panel 6 is fixedly mounted on the two ends of body 1.Rear panel 6 bottoms are provided with open slot, are ㄇ shape, and rear panel 6 lower openings partly are convenient to insert parts such as hard disc data line and power interface.The bottom side portion of body 1 both sides is provided with the limited step 9 that extends outward, and limited step 9 is provided with mounting hole with base plate 10, and screw is located in the described mounting hole.
In use, damping nut 4 is installed on the fixed installation hole 3 of these heating radiator both sides, effect with damping, energy-absorbing, with this heating radiator cabinet of packing into, being installed in cabinet hangs in the slot of CD-ROM drive, when hard disk was worked, damping nut 4 absorbed the energy of the vibration of the on-stream generation of hard disk, thereby is hard disk shock-absorbing effectively.
